This clip shows the model proa accelerate in a gust:
http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=9CqK96VfQRk
I was a bit slow on the shunt so beached it.

It needs sheet control to adjust the sail cant to sustain conditions like this to avoid the leeward bow digging in. However it demonstrates the ability to lift the forward sections of the windward hull and begin to fly. On the full size version the weight of the lee hull will be relatively lower so the CoG will be very close to the windward hull giving it the tendency to roll into the wind when the sail is canted correctly.
